Optical Performance and Specifications
The 70-millimeter diameter objective lens provides sufficient light-gathering area for observing most basic astronomical objects. The 400mm focal length ensures a wide field of view, which is ideal for sky orientation and observing larger objects such as star clusters or nebulae. The f/5.7 focal ratio classifies this telescope as a fast system, suitable for both visual observation and basic astrophotography.
Technical Specifications
- Aperture: 70mm
- Focal length: 400mm
- Focal ratio: f/5.7
- Mount type: Azimuthal on tabletop tripod
- Optical design: Achromatic refractor
- Maximum useful magnification: 140x
Observing Capabilities
With this telescope, you can discover fascinating details of the Moon, including its craters, lunar seas, and mountain ranges. The moon filter included in the package reduces glare and allows comfortable observation of our closest celestial neighbor. Planets of the solar system will reveal their secrets - on Jupiter you will recognize its largest moons and characteristic bands in the atmosphere, Saturn will show you its majestic rings, and Mars will reveal polar caps and dark areas on the surface.
In darker locations away from urban light pollution, you can also observe deep sky objects. Double stars, star clusters such as the Pleiades or the Hercules Cluster, and bright nebulae including the Great Orion Nebula become accessible targets for your observation. A beginner telescope should be capable of showing these basic objects, and the Traveler 70/400 fulfills this requirement effortlessly.
Terrestrial Observation Features
One of the distinctive advantages of this telescope is the possibility of terrestrial observation. Unlike purely astronomical telescopes, the Binorum Traveler provides an upright image, making it suitable for observing landscapes, architecture, or wildlife at a distance. This feature increases the practical value of the instrument and allows its use during daylight hours.

Maintenance and Care
Maintenance of the Binorum Traveler is minimal and does not require special knowledge. Optical elements need only occasional cleaning with a special optical cloth, mechanical parts only need checking and tightening if necessary. During transport, it is advisable to store the telescope in its original packaging or a special bag to ensure protection of optics and mechanics.
It is recommended to avoid touching optical surfaces with fingers and when cleaning, use only special cleaning products designed for optics. Regular checking of screw connections ensures long-term stability and reliability of the instrument.
